I have said that I prefer long races and winner breaks to short sets.

If you have a problem with that, too bad.

Match of 3 sets to 25

1st set you win 25 - 24
2nd set I win 25 - 1
3rd set you win 25 - 24

You won the match.

You have won a total of 51 games (25 + 1 + 25)
I have won a total of 73 games (24 + 24 + 25)

I beat you 73 - 51 in games.

When you play one long race to 75 games, the winner is the person with the most games won.

I prefer to play that way.

You play however you want.
